61. Orpheus – The legendary musician of Greek myth, Orpheus brings an artistic and enchanting quality to Hoyt.

62. Atticus – Made famous by “To Kill a Mockingbird,” Atticus embodies wisdom, integrity, and quiet strength, a perfect match for Hoyt.

63. Apollo – The Greek god of music, poetry, and light, Apollo adds a radiant and artistic flair to Hoyt.

64. Gideon – A biblical hero known for his courage, Gideon offers a strong and inspiring presence alongside Hoyt.

65. Finnian – Often associated with Irish legends and the scholar Fionn mac Cumhaill, Finnian has a magical and adventurous feel for Hoyt.

66. Evander – A heroic figure in Roman mythology, Evander means “good man,” offering a noble and classic feel to Hoyt.

67. Lysander – A name from Shakespeare, Lysander is romantic and has a lyrical quality that suits Hoyt.

68. Caspian – Popularized by C.S. Lewis’s “Chronicles of Narnia,” Caspian evokes adventure and a sense of wonder with Hoyt.

69. Percival – A knight of the Round Table, Percival signifies purity and a questing spirit, a fine companion to Hoyt.

70. Oberon – The king of the fairies in Shakespeare’s “A Midsummer Night’s Dream,” Oberon adds a touch of enchantment to Hoyt.

71. Remus – One of the mythical founders of Rome, Remus offers a sense of ancient history and strong beginnings with Hoyt.

72. Tristan – A legendary lover from Arthurian romance, Tristan brings a romantic and adventurous spirit to Hoyt.
